Pests Attack on the Citrus Tree causes leaf curling Aphids spider mites citrus leaf miners mealybugs and scale insects are common sap-sucking pests. Mist the lemon tree to compensate for dry air due to artificial air currents in the home. If the soil at the base of the tree is dry then you need to increase watering and add up to 10cm of organic mulch to the base of the tree to keep the moisture in.
